La Lechere Guest House

La Lechere Guest House Address: 8 Sysie Avenue Po Box 234, Phalaborwa, South Africa

Minimum price found for La Lechere Guest House was: Null ZAR

Click here to get more information, photos & guest ratings for La Lechere Guest House